Join the NEW Speeders Calgary Chinook

Speeders Calgary Chinook is set to become the city’s premier entertainment destination, and we’re looking for dynamic individuals to join us on this thrilling journey. Our massive, state-of-the-art facility features Two multi-level race tracks, bowling, Axe throwing, laser tag, mini golf, Full service restaurant and bar, and more exciting attractions. We’re redefining fun in Calgary, and now we’re seeking a driven and passionate “Assistant General Manager” to help steer our success to new heights.

Why You’ll Love Working with Us:
At Speeders, every day is a new adventure. As part of our leadership team, you’ll be in the heart of the action, playing a pivotal role in shaping unforgettable experiences for our guests. If you’re someone who thrives in a fast-paced, high-energy environment and loves the idea of making a real impact, this is the perfect role for you.

What You’ll Do:
As our “Assistant General Manager”, you’ll be the driving force behind our operations, ensuring everything runs smoothly and efficiently. You’ll work closely with the General Manager to manage day-to-day activities, lead and inspire our team, and deliver outstanding customer service. Your role will be critical in maintaining our reputation as Calgary’s top entertainment hub.

Key Responsibilities:

- Oversee daily operations across all departments, including racetracks, bar, restaurant, and other attractions.
- Lead, mentor, and develop team members to provide exceptional service.
- Ensure operational efficiency and uphold our high standards of customer satisfaction.
- Assist in financial management, including budgeting, forecasting, and cost control.
- Handle guest inquiries, feedback, and resolve any issues promptly and professionally.
- Collaborate with the General Manager on strategic planning and business development.
- Drive continuous improvement initiatives to enhance guest experiences and operational performance.

What We’re Looking For:

- Proven experience in a managerial or leadership role, preferably in the hospitality, entertainment, or service industry.
- Strong organizational and multitasking abilities to manage a diverse set of responsibilities.
- Exceptional communication and interpersonal skills to lead a dynamic team and interact with guests.
- A passion for creating memorable experiences and a commitment to excellence in customer service.
- 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ment and adapt to changing circumstances.
- A proactive, solution-oriented mindset with a focus on achieving results.
